I’m excited and honoured to be invited as a Guest Designer for Time Out Challenge # 201.

The challenge is to create cards inspired by the words:“Simplicity is the ultimate sophistication “ by Leonardo Da Vinci. You can be inspired by any part of the quote.

Sponsoring this challenge is the incredible and very generous CAS-ual Fridays Stamps! You could win a $25 voucher to their amazing store. Our design team will also vote for another winner who gets to join them as guest designer in a future challenge. 

I love this quote which made me think of the simple beauty of nature. For this reason I selcted the simple but striking images in Altnew – Tropical Jungle stamp set.

After stamping the tall image in black ink, it was watercoloured with Distress Inks and fussy cut.

The slimline card front was stamped with the longer leaf image in black ink. This was then overlayed with a strip of vellum to soften the look of the stamping.

After adding the coloured image, the simple white heat embossed ‘Thanks’ from the set was added to the bottom with raised tape.

I feel this simple card design has an element of sophistication with this spike of vibrant coloured blooms. I hope you agree.
